Understanding Volatility and Return to Player (RTP)

One of the most crucial aspects of understanding any slot game, whether it's a classic three-reel design or a modern five-reel video slot, is grasping the concept of volatility. Often referred to as variance, volatility dictates how frequently a slot pays out and the typical size of those payouts. High volatility slots offer larger potential wins but do so less frequently, demanding more patience and a larger bankroll. Low volatility slots, conversely, provide more frequent, albeit smaller, wins, extending playtime and reducing risk. Choosing a game with a volatility level aligned with your risk tolerance is paramount to an enjoyable experience. Players should research the volatility before committing significant funds. Understanding this element can significantly impact your strategy and expectations.

Complementary to volatility is the Return to Player (RTP) percentage. RTP represents the theoretical amount of money a slot machine will pay back to players over an extended period. Expressed as a percentage, an RTP of 96% means that, on average, the game will return $96 for every $100 wagered. It’s important to note that RTP is a long-term average and does not guarantee winnings in any single session. However, selecting games with higher RTP percentages generally increases your odds of success over time. Responsible players consider RTP alongside volatility to make informed decisions. Online casinos often publish the RTP of their slot games, providing transparency for players.

The Impact of Random Number Generators (RNGs)

The fairness and randomness of slot games are guaranteed by Random Number Generators (RNGs). These sophisticated algorithms ensure that each spin's outcome is entirely independent and unpredictable. RNGs are regularly tested and certified by independent auditing agencies to verify their integrity. It's crucial to only play at casinos that utilize certified RNGs, guaranteeing a fair gaming environment. Without a reliable RNG, the game's results wouldn't be truly random, potentially leading to manipulation or unfair outcomes. The consistent verification process builds trust and accountability within the online gaming industry. This ensures players have a genuine chance of winning.

Decoding the Paytable and Symbol Types

Before spinning the reels, a thorough examination of the paytable is essential. The paytable outlines the winning combinations, the value of each symbol, and any bonus features the game offers. It acts as a crucial guide to understanding how the game functions and what you need to achieve to trigger a payout. Paytables often differ significantly between games, even within the same provider, so it's important to familiarize yourself with each game’s specific rules. Ignoring the paytable is akin to playing blindfolded, significantly reducing your chances of success. The paytable will also detail the minimum bet required to be eligible for all features and jackpots.

Symbols in slot games typically fall into several categories: high-value, low-value, and special symbols. High-value symbols generally appear less frequently but offer substantial payouts when they form winning combinations. Low-value symbols appear more often but yield smaller rewards. Special symbols, such as wilds and scatters, trigger bonus features or modify the game’s mechanics. Wilds substitute for other symbols to complete winning lines, while scatters often activate free spins or bonus rounds. Understanding the role of each symbol is critical to maximizing your potential winnings and unlocking the game’s full potential. Recognizing these elements allows for a more calculated approach to gameplay.

The Significance of Bonus Features

Bonus features significantly enhance the excitement and potential rewards of slot games. These features are typically triggered by specific symbol combinations, often involving scatters. Common bonus features include free spins, where players can spin the reels without wagering additional funds; multipliers, which increase the value of winning combinations; and bonus games, which involve interactive challenges or mini-games with the chance to win additional prizes. The complexity and generosity of bonus features vary widely between games. Players should actively seek out games with engaging and rewarding bonus features to elevate their gaming experience. Familiarizing yourself with the activation conditions of these bonuses is crucial.

  • Free Spins: Allow players to spin without wagering.
  • Multipliers: Increase the payout of winning combinations.
  • Bonus Games: Offer interactive challenges and additional prizes.
  • Wild Symbols: Substitute for other symbols to complete winning lines.
  • Scatter Symbols: Often trigger bonus features or free spins.

The inclusion of these features adds layers of complexity and strategic depth to the gameplay, transforming a simple spinning experience into a thrilling adventure. It is not uncommon for progressive jackpots to be activated during bonus rounds, adding an extra layer of excitement.

Strategies for Responsible Gameplay

While slot games are undeniably entertaining, it's crucial to approach them with responsible gambling practices. Setting a budget before you start playing and sticking to it is paramount. Treat your gambling funds as entertainment expenses and avoid chasing losses. Chasing losses can quickly lead to financial difficulties and a negative gaming experience. It’s also essential to understand that slots are games of chance, and there’s no foolproof strategy to guarantee a win. Avoid believing in myths or systems that promise consistent success; these are often misleading and can lead to poor decision-making. Remember to take frequent breaks to maintain perspective and avoid becoming overly engrossed in the game.

Self-exclusion programs offered by many online casinos provide a valuable tool for players who feel they are losing control over their gambling habits. These programs allow you to temporarily or permanently block yourself from accessing the casino’s services. Utilizing these resources demonstrates a commitment to responsible gambling and prioritizes your well-being. Furthermore, be mindful of the time you spend playing and ensure it doesn’t interfere with your personal or professional obligations. Gambling should be a leisure activity, not a source of stress or financial hardship. Playing should always be an enjoyable experience.

Recognizing Problem Gambling Signs

Being aware of the signs of problem gambling is crucial, both for yourself and for those around you. These signs include gambling more than you can afford to lose, neglecting personal responsibilities due to gambling, lying to others about your gambling habits, and experiencing feelings of guilt or regret after gambling. If you recognize these behaviors in yourself or someone you know, seeking help is essential. Numerous organizations offer support and resources for problem gamblers, including helplines, counseling services, and support groups. Acknowledging the issue is the first step toward recovery and regaining control.

The Future of Slot Gaming: Innovation and Technology

The world of slot gaming is constantly evolving, driven by advancements in technology and changing player preferences. Virtual Reality (VR) and Augmented Reality (AR) are poised to revolutionize the experience, offering immersive and interactive gameplay. Imagine stepping inside a virtual casino or having slot machines come to life in your living room – these possibilities are rapidly becoming realities. Furthermore, the integration of blockchain technology and cryptocurrencies is introducing new levels of transparency and security to online gambling. These innovations are not merely cosmetic; they fundamentally alter the way we interact with these games, offering a more engaging and secure experience.

The trend towards mobile gaming continues to dominate the industry, with an increasing number of players opting to access their favorite slots on smartphones and tablets. This demand has driven developers to create mobile-first games optimized for smaller screens and touch controls. Personalization is another key area of focus, with algorithms analyzing player behavior to tailor game recommendations and bonus offers. As the industry matures, we can expect to see even more sophisticated features and immersive experiences that cater to the evolving needs and expectations of players. The potential for gamification, incorporating elements of storytelling and player progression, also offers exciting avenues for future development. The Appeal of Themed Slots and Branded Partnerships

One striking trend in the evolution of digital slot experiences lies in the proliferation of themed slots and branded partnerships. Developers are increasingly licensing popular intellectual property – films, TV shows, music artists, and even video games – to create slots that resonate deeply with specific fan bases. This strategy taps into pre-existing emotional connections and brand loyalty, attracting players who are already invested in the source material. The visual and audio elements of these slots are often meticulously crafted to mirror the original IP, enhancing the immersive experience and providing a sense of familiarity. This approach can transform a simple spin of the reels into a nostalgic journey or an exciting adventure within a beloved universe.

Beyond the appeal to existing fan bases, branded slots offer a unique marketing opportunity for both the game developer and the IP owner. The slot serves as a form of interactive entertainment that extends the reach of the brand and engages audiences in a novel way. Successful partnerships are often characterized by a creative synergy between the developer and the IP owner, resulting in a game that feels authentic and respectful of the original source material. Players are drawn not only to the potential for winning but also to the opportunity to immerse themselves in a world they already appreciate. This symbiotic relationship continues to fuel the demand for innovative and captivating themed experiences.
